Home
last modified time | relevance | path

Searched refs:m_current_value (Results 1 – 22 of 22) sorted by relevance

/freebsd/contrib/llvm-project/lldb/include/lldb/Interpreter/
H A DOptionValueBoolean.h19 : m_current_value(value), m_default_value(value) {} in OptionValueBoolean()
21 : m_current_value(current_value), m_default_value(default_value) {} in OptionValueBoolean()
33 return m_current_value; in ToJSON()
41 m_current_value = m_default_value; in Clear()
63 explicit operator bool() const { return m_current_value; }
66 m_current_value = b;
67 return m_current_value;
70 bool GetCurrentValue() const { return m_current_value; } in GetCurrentValue()
74 void SetCurrentValue(bool value) { m_current_value = value; } in SetCurrentValue()
79 bool m_current_value;
H A DOptionValueChar.h19 : m_current_value(value), m_default_value(value) {} in OptionValueChar()
22 : m_current_value(current_value), m_default_value(default_value) {} in OptionValueChar()
34 return m_current_value; in ToJSON()
42 m_current_value = m_default_value; in Clear()
49 m_current_value = c;
50 return m_current_value;
53 char GetCurrentValue() const { return m_current_value; } in GetCurrentValue()
57 void SetCurrentValue(char value) { m_current_value = value; } in SetCurrentValue()
62 char m_current_value;
H A DOptionValueUInt64.h22 : m_current_value(value), m_default_value(value) {} in OptionValueUInt64()
25 : m_current_value(current_value), m_default_value(default_value) {} in OptionValueUInt64()
42 return m_current_value; in ToJSON()
50 m_current_value = m_default_value; in Clear()
57 m_current_value = value;
58 return m_current_value;
61 operator uint64_t() const { return m_current_value; } in uint64_t()
63 uint64_t GetCurrentValue() const { return m_current_value; } in GetCurrentValue()
69 m_current_value = value; in SetCurrentValue()
92 uint64_t m_current_value = 0;
H A DOptionValueArch.h22 OptionValueArch(const char *triple) : m_current_value(triple) { in OptionValueArch()
23 m_default_value = m_current_value; in OptionValueArch()
27 : m_current_value(value), m_default_value(value) {} in OptionValueArch()
30 : m_current_value(current_value), m_default_value(default_value) {} in OptionValueArch()
46 m_current_value = m_default_value; in Clear()
55 ArchSpec &GetCurrentValue() { return m_current_value; } in GetCurrentValue()
57 const ArchSpec &GetCurrentValue() const { return m_current_value; } in GetCurrentValue()
62 m_current_value = value; in SetCurrentValue()
70 ArchSpec m_current_value;
H A DOptionValueString.h33 m_current_value.assign(value); in OptionValueString()
40 m_current_value.assign(current_value); in OptionValueString()
49 m_current_value.assign(value); in m_validator()
58 m_current_value.assign(current_value); in m_validator()
73 return m_current_value; in ToJSON()
81 m_current_value = m_default_value; in Clear()
93 return m_current_value.c_str();
96 const char *GetCurrentValue() const { return m_current_value.c_str(); } in GetCurrentValue()
97 llvm::StringRef GetCurrentValueAsRef() const { return m_current_value; } in GetCurrentValueAsRef()
113 bool IsCurrentValueEmpty() const { return m_current_value.empty(); } in IsCurrentValueEmpty()
[all …]
H A DOptionValueSInt64.h22 : m_current_value(value), m_default_value(value) {} in OptionValueSInt64()
25 : m_current_value(current_value), m_default_value(default_value) {} in OptionValueSInt64()
39 return m_current_value; in ToJSON()
47 m_current_value = m_default_value; in Clear()
54 m_current_value = value;
55 return m_current_value;
58 int64_t GetCurrentValue() const { return m_current_value; } in GetCurrentValue()
64 m_current_value = value; in SetCurrentValue()
87 int64_t m_current_value = 0;
H A DOptionValueFormat.h20 : m_current_value(value), m_default_value(value) {} in OptionValueFormat()
23 : m_current_value(current_value), m_default_value(default_value) {} in OptionValueFormat()
41 m_current_value = m_default_value; in Clear()
47 lldb::Format GetCurrentValue() const { return m_current_value; } in GetCurrentValue()
51 void SetCurrentValue(lldb::Format value) { m_current_value = value; } in SetCurrentValue()
56 lldb::Format m_current_value;
H A DOptionValueLanguage.h21 : m_current_value(value), m_default_value(value) {} in OptionValueLanguage()
25 : m_current_value(current_value), m_default_value(default_value) {} in OptionValueLanguage()
43 m_current_value = m_default_value; in Clear()
49 lldb::LanguageType GetCurrentValue() const { return m_current_value; } in GetCurrentValue()
53 void SetCurrentValue(lldb::LanguageType value) { m_current_value = value; } in SetCurrentValue()
58 lldb::LanguageType m_current_value;
H A DOptionValueEnumeration.h49 m_current_value = m_default_value; in Clear()
59 m_current_value = value;
60 return m_current_value;
63 enum_type GetCurrentValue() const { return m_current_value; } in GetCurrentValue()
67 void SetCurrentValue(enum_type value) { m_current_value = value; } in SetCurrentValue()
74 enum_type m_current_value; variable
H A DOptionValueFileSpecList.h25 : Cloneable(other), m_current_value(other.GetCurrentValue()) {} in OptionValueFileSpecList()
42 m_current_value.Clear(); in Clear()
52 return m_current_value; in GetCurrentValue()
57 m_current_value = value; in SetCurrentValue()
62 m_current_value.Append(value); in AppendCurrentValue()
69 FileSpecList m_current_value; variable
H A DOptionValueFileSpec.h39 return m_current_value.GetPath(); in ToJSON()
47 m_current_value = m_default_value; in Clear()
58 FileSpec &GetCurrentValue() { return m_current_value; } in GetCurrentValue()
60 const FileSpec &GetCurrentValue() const { return m_current_value; } in GetCurrentValue()
65 m_current_value = value; in SetCurrentValue()
78 FileSpec m_current_value;
/freebsd/contrib/llvm-project/lldb/source/Interpreter/
H A DOptionValueString.cpp25 if (!m_current_value.empty() || m_value_was_set) { in DumpValue()
28 Args::ExpandEscapedCharacters(m_current_value.c_str(), in DumpValue()
36 strm.Printf("%s", m_current_value.c_str()); in DumpValue()
38 strm.Printf("\"%s\"", m_current_value.c_str()); in DumpValue()
78 std::string new_value(m_current_value); in SetValueFromString()
92 m_current_value.assign(new_value); in SetValueFromString()
110 Args::EncodeEscapeSequences(value_str.c_str(), m_current_value); in SetValueFromString()
126 m_current_value.assign(std::string(value)); in SetCurrentValue()
133 std::string new_value(m_current_value); in AppendToCurrentValue()
138 m_current_value.assign(new_value); in AppendToCurrentValue()
[all …]
H A DOptionValueFileSpec.cpp24 : m_current_value(value), m_default_value(value), in OptionValueFileSpec()
31 : m_current_value(current_value), m_default_value(default_value), in OptionValueFileSpec()
43 if (m_current_value) { in DumpValue()
44 strm << '"' << m_current_value.GetPath().c_str() << '"'; in DumpValue()
63 m_current_value.SetFile(value.str(), FileSpec::Style::native); in SetValueFromString()
65 FileSystem::Instance().Resolve(m_current_value); in SetValueFromString()
92 if (m_current_value) { in GetFileContents()
93 const auto file_mod_time = FileSystem::Instance().GetModificationTime(m_current_value); in GetFileContents()
97 FileSystem::Instance().CreateDataBuffer(m_current_value.GetPath()); in GetFileContents()
H A DOptionValueFileSpecList.cpp24 const uint32_t size = m_current_value.GetSize(); in DumpValue()
27 (m_current_value.GetSize() > 0 && !one_line) ? "\n" : ""); in DumpValue()
35 m_current_value.GetFileSpecAtIndex(i).Dump(strm.AsRawOstream()); in DumpValue()
60 const uint32_t count = m_current_value.GetSize(); in SetValueFromString()
69 m_current_value.Replace(idx, file); in SetValueFromString()
71 m_current_value.Append(file); in SetValueFromString()
82 m_current_value.Clear(); in SetValueFromString()
90 m_current_value.Append(file); in SetValueFromString()
103 const uint32_t count = m_current_value.GetSize(); in SetValueFromString()
113 m_current_value.Insert(idx, file); in SetValueFromString()
[all …]
H A DOptionValueLanguage.cpp27 if (m_current_value != eLanguageTypeUnknown) in DumpValue()
28 strm.PutCString(Language::GetNameForLanguageType(m_current_value)); in DumpValue()
33 return Language::GetNameForLanguageType(m_current_value); in ToJSON()
50 m_current_value = new_type; in SetValueFromString()
H A DOptionValueChar.cpp27 if (m_current_value != '\0') in DumpValue()
28 strm.PutChar(m_current_value); in DumpValue()
47 m_current_value = char_value; in SetValueFromString()
H A DOptionValueEnumeration.cpp18 : m_current_value(value), m_default_value(value) { in OptionValueEnumeration()
31 if (m_enumerations.GetValueAtIndexUnchecked(i).value == m_current_value) { in DumpValue()
36 strm.Printf("%" PRIu64, (uint64_t)m_current_value); in DumpValue()
55 m_current_value = enumerator_entry->value.value; in SetValueFromString()
H A DOptionValueFormat.cpp25 strm.PutCString(FormatManager::GetFormatAsCString(m_current_value)); in DumpValue()
30 return FormatManager::GetFormatAsCString(m_current_value); in ToJSON()
48 m_current_value = new_format; in SetValueFromString()
H A DOptionValueArch.cpp28 if (m_current_value.IsValid()) { in DumpValue()
29 const char *arch_name = m_current_value.GetArchitectureName(); in DumpValue()
48 if (m_current_value.SetTriple(value_str.c_str())) { in SetValueFromString()
H A DOptionValueSInt64.cpp28 strm.Printf("%" PRIi64, m_current_value); in DumpValue()
48 m_current_value = value; in SetValueFromString()
H A DOptionValueBoolean.cpp29 strm.PutCString(m_current_value ? "true" : "false"); in DumpValue()
48 m_current_value = value; in SetValueFromString()
H A DOptionValueUInt64.cpp32 strm.Printf("%" PRIu64, m_current_value); in DumpValue()
52 m_current_value = value; in SetValueFromString()